Pedestrian Hit Last Week Identified as Eureka Man

Press release from the Humboldt County Coroner:

hcsoOn September 27, 2015 at about 0205 hours California Highway Patrol Officers responded to a traffic collision on US-101 southbound, north of Humboldt Hill. A 1999 Cadillac Escalade driven by Teresa Louise Graham, age 28, collided with a pedestrian wearing dark clothing and walking across traffic lanes. The pedestrian suffered major injuries and was later pronounced deceased at St. Joseph’s Hospital. At the time of the accident the deceased person’s identity was unknown.

Using finger print analysis the Coroner’s office has positively identified the deceased person as William Emery Seekins, Age 29, from Eureka. The California Highway Patrol is the lead agency in this investigation and all further information will be released through their agency.
